### GC pauses in Matchbox

Heads up: Matchbox, our pairing service, occasionally hits garbage-collection pauses of 200–400ms under heavy queue load. The client retries automatically, but if you're timing a release, don't panic when p99 latency spikes briefly after deploy — the heap settles within a few minutes. You can watch pause metrics via the internal stats endpoint, which requires authentication. Use the key below when calling it.

service key, fawip-bajef: kto11_Qt5wZK9vdNC

Handover: Exportron retry queue

Hi Mira — handing over the failed-export retries. Exports that hit a timeout land in the retry queue and get three attempts with backoff; after that they're parked and need a manual requeue from the admin panel. Watch for customers reporting duplicates — that usually means a double requeue. The current retry settings are as follows.

settings of bajog-fawig:
oliael:
  log_level: warn
  metrics_host: metrics.oliael.zemvarsys.internal
  pin: 0267
  pool_size: 32

**FAQ: Unlocking the Lanternflag rollout vault**

Q: The Lanternflag framework refuses to flip flags and reports the policy vault is sealed. What now?

A: This happens after a failed sync with the Drossmere config store. Restart the flag daemon first. If it stays sealed, halt in-flight rollouts, note the incident in the release log, and unseal with the recovery passphrase provided below.

recovery phrase for kajop-yagef: istael-ulaius

Release step 4 for the Quillrun markdown pipeline: double-check the sanitizer allowlist didn't drift, since last release we accidentally let raw iframes through and Marguerite had a long week. Run the golden-file suite against both the legacy renderer and the new streaming one; diffs should be zero. If you see whitespace-only diffs, that's the known tokenizer quirk, safe to ignore. Then cut the release candidate and note its build token below.

pipeline stamp: htk9_ce63042d9